Transaction 66044d72380a4f91791b28c29a0afaa603c478f8294baff902b94543dd186621

1 Input
2 Outputs
  • 66044d72380a4f91791b28c29a0afaa603c478f8294baff902b94543dd186621:0
  • value  120889250
    address  1Npe9S4Z78XazFG95TxiYsV9yWfRZJBgYg
  • 66044d72380a4f91791b28c29a0afaa603c478f8294baff902b94543dd186621:1
  • value  189050000
    address  15ZJNsw1uZz91XXFWPqGVjV1knBkD4xa7j